Welcome to my blog about one of my biggest interests, no, passions, well, obsession, which is the traditional or vernacular Chicago apartment building. The focus of this blog is going to be on pre-war buildings, however I will try to feature some from newer vintages and other locations for fun as well.

There are a lot of things that make Chicago a great city, but our housing stock is one of the unsung heroes in that greatness. I had originally wanted to name this blog "Beyond the Bungalow", but unfortunately, that name has already been taken as the title of a book about Bungalows and the Craftsman movement. However, fear not, this blog will not dwell on 4+1's in the least (though, at some point, they may be illustrated as an example), but was suggested by a friend (Thanks Geaux!). And sorry Herr Van der Rohe, but neither your luxus palazzo residence or luxurious steel and glass towers is home to the average Chicagoan (wonderful as both types are) who lives beyond the lakefront.

One of my first tasks will be to categories or create a typology of the basic types of apartment buildings found in Chicago.
